WebA total of 221 bronchoalveolar lavage (BAL) fluid samples were evaluated for the presence of Pneumocystis DNA by the LightCycler and compared to fluorescent microscopy using calcofluor white staining. Of the 221, 24 were positive and 190 were negative by both detection methods. WebAug 14, 2014 · Pneumocystis jirovecii pneumonia (PCP), caused by the fungus P. jirovecii (formerly P. carinii ), is a life-threatening, opportunistic infection that is often the AIDS-defining illness in patients with HIV infection. Consequently, PCP has been extensively studied as a manifestation of the AIDS epidemic. WebSep 12, 2024 · Pneumocystis jirovecii pneumonia (formerly called Pneumocystis carinii pneumonia or PCP) is the most common opportunistic respiratory infection in patients with acquired immunodeficiency syndrome (AIDS).

WebThis type of pneumonia is caused by the fungus Pneumocystis jiroveci. This fungus is common in the environment and rarely causes illness in healthy people. However, it can cause a lung infection in people with a weakened immune system due to: Cancer. Long-term use of corticosteroids or other medicines that weaken the immune system.
